Transaction 56f7679e21bef160e338a8a570b90a301cd2cac4f50870588a5dc78e6231cebf
1 Input
1 Output
-
56f7679e21bef160e338a8a570b90a301cd2cac4f50870588a5dc78e6231cebf:0
- value
- 128906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ad851f959482857823912991a0af5d042f4b2f86 OP_EQUAL
- address
- 3HWWJJdRf1JWV9SxbyADo4b1GAfXSBDvCK